The state Supreme Court is scheduled to begin its second oral argument session of 2010 today in Pittsburgh, and at the top of the arguments list are cases dealing with UM/UIM issues, including waiver of coverage.

In addition, the justices will also be hearing a case that poses the question of whether supermarkets may conduct takeout beer sales, and another on how to properly determine the length of an oil and gas lease.
